Getting Organized for the New Year
Dear Myrtle has a wonderful (and detailed) checklist to help genealogy enthusiasts get organized. Plus it comes with links to useful sites!
One of my 2009 resolutions is to record my family tree information in a more timely manner instead of filing things away to record later. By the time I get back to these documents and notes, I can't remember what I've recorded or where.
With any luck, some of my distant cousins will find me in 2009 because of the forums, family sites, and blogs where I've mentioned the surnames and places I'm researching. Happy new year and looking forward to hearing from YOU:
Schwartz family from Ungvar (parents: Herman Schwartz and wife Hanna or Hani Simonowitz)
Birk family from Russia (Isaac Birk, possibly Lithuania)
Mahler family from Latvia (Meyer Mahler)
Luria family from Kovno (Hinde Luria)
